dollhousetvforum.com recently posted an exclusive interview with two of the Dollhouse staff writers Elizabeth Craft and Sarah Fain. The spoiler-free interview is an excellent behind-the-scenes look at the upcoming series.
Is the plan to lean towards "adventure of the week" or with a more "arc" approach?

The show will be episodic and serialized-- meaning every week we'll be telling a story with a beginning, middle, and end, but every week we'll also be weaving in the serialized elements of the Big Story. Sometimes that'll be in smaller, subtle ways, other times those elements will be front and center.

Updated profile & photo of Helo at Scifi.com

As part of the redesign of their Battlestar site, Sci-fi has added a new profile photo and character description for Helo to their Cast page:

As the husband of the Cylon Sharon and the father of the first human-Cylon baby, Hera, pilot Karl Agathon (callsign "Helo") knows what it's like to be on the periphery of the Galactica's community. The days when his fellow officers publicly ostracized him for loving a "toaster" are over, but his colleagues are still sometimes disconcerted by his compassion not only for Cylons but also for marginalized humans within the fleet. He once sabotaged a plan to unleash a genocidal virus against the Cylons and has also defied the Galactica's leadership on behalf of persecuted Sagittaron refugees. Despite — or perhaps because of — this, Admiral Adama trusts Helo, assigning him to various critical leadership positions.
